Transaction eac683c79166c77dc1f81524da767c03b41eb413fd66c14456efa73dda3ada63
1 Input
1 Output
-
eac683c79166c77dc1f81524da767c03b41eb413fd66c14456efa73dda3ada63:0
- value
- 28866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97d3f283878a264d4849c4c736b86a9b3eea7bef OP_EQUAL
- address
- 3FXorsJTWxLfmeMUoT7SwiLMuXRdPYT3Fg